The landscape of higher education is rife with intricate legal, financial, and societal challenges that general counsels must navigate skillfully. David Simon, former general counsel of the Philadelphia College of Osteopathic Medicine, articulates that the issues within academia are particularly compelling at present. The dynamic environment places university legal advisors in a position where they must grapple with a myriad of issues, ranging from regulatory compliance to evolving societal expectations.
University general counsels are increasingly expected to manage an ‘A to Z’ roster of concerns that touch on various dimensions of institutional operations. This includes navigating new legislation, addressing concerns around free speech, and overseeing complex financial arrangements while also remaining committed to diversity, equity, and inclusion initiatives.
